If you want to check off your Central Park must-see list, this is the tour for you! Join your guides as we visit the Park’s most famous and endearing sites. See the Manhattan skyline from Sheep Meadow, walk under the gorgeous American elms that line the Mall, capture a picture at the movie-perfect Bethesda Terrace, and gaze on the picturesque Lake and its famed boathouse. Learn how the Central Park designers and architects transformed rocky and swampy land into the work of art that is Central Park today.
Recommended for first-time visitors or those interested in Central Park’s most famous sites.

Your guide will meet you at Columbus Circle to begin your tour of Central Park.
Visit Greyshot Arch, one of the many bridges and arches found in Central Park.
We will stop by Pinebank Arch, an elegant cast-iron bridge that is one of the most distinctive ornamental elements in the south end of Central Park.
Visit Heckscher Ballfields, as area that has been reserved for playing field games since the Park's creation.
See the Manhattan skyline from Sheep Meadow.
Your tour will end at Bethesda Terrace, with its famous fountain and beautiful views of the Lake and boathouse.
